What the Varanasi to Delhi road is actually like

Delhi to Varanasi is a night's driving rather than a day's, and nearly all of it is expressway now. We leave on the Yamuna Expressway, empty and fast after dark, take the Agra bypass without entering the city, and pick up the Agra-Lucknow Expressway at its western end. That stretch runs flat and straight through Firozabad, Etawah and Kannauj country for hours, with lit rest areas where the driver can stretch his legs and the passengers can find a toilet and tea. Past Lucknow the route splits: the Purvanchal Expressway carries a car on east, while the older road through Sultanpur and Jaunpur is what we take when the expressway is shut. Either way the last hour into Varanasi is ordinary two-lane road shared with tractors and cycles, best done in daylight. In December and January fog sits on the Agra-Lucknow section from midnight until well after sunrise, and we slow right down or halt at Lucknow. The monsoon does not trouble the expressways. Breakfast is kachori and sabzi once the sun is up.

Is Banaras to Delhi the same as Varanasi to Delhi?

Yes. Varanasi is also called Banaras (Benares) and, in its temple sense, Kashi. The distance, the road and the fare on this page are the same journey under either name.
